This is the reason that today's infrastructure looks so different compared to what it used to resemble; advancements in modern-day technology have actually re-shaped and revolutionised the way these infrastructure projects are planned, regulated and constructed. For instance, among the leading technological innovations in infrastructure is the use of drones and robotics on the construction sites of numerous infrastructure ventures. So, why is this? To put it simply, drones provide real-time aerial surveillance, track project progression and perform routine evaluations, whilst robots have the ability to take on the more lengthy, labour-intensive or potentially harmful jobs, such as bricklaying, material handling, and demolition. The best aspect of using these types of modern technologies is the easy truth that it can boost accuracy, speed up the efficiency of projects and most significantly, lower the risk of human injury.
